To understand the music you're searching for, it's essential to look back at the decade. The 1990s in Italy were a period of immense creative ferment. On one hand, the tradition of the great Italian cantautore continued to thrive. Artists like gave us anthems like "Sally" (1996), while Luciano Ligabue became a rock icon with his debut album and its track "Piccola stella senza cielo" (1990). The legendary Lucio Dalla charmed the nation with the unforgettable "Attenti al lupo" (1990). Meanwhile, the Sanremo festival launched new stars, giving the world Laura Pausini 's emotional ballad "La solitudine" (1993) and establishing the duo Amedeo Minghi and Mietta with the timeless duet "Vattene Amore" (1990).
